This is because of the way the Inserts tab of the Pro Tools I/O window is configured you cannot configure insert send and returns to be on non-matching I/O. For example, if you want to send audio to a hardware compressor on output 5, the output of the compressor must come back into Pro Tools on Input 5. When using your interface I/O as insert points for hardware units, it is essential that you use matching numbered inputs and outputs. But before we get into all that, let’s look at the mechanics of getting an outboard dynamics processor and reverb unit hooked up to Pro Tools. The good news is that the Avid Audio Engine introduced in Pro Tools 11 has streamlined the use of delay compensation, which is vital when you’re using your interface to route audio out to a hardware processor and back into Pro Tools.

In this month’s Pro Tools workshop we will be looking at how to integrate hardware effects units into Pro Tools and use delay compensation to adjust for any latency involved in sending signals to and from them.Īlthough most of us are doing more and more ‘in the box’ these days, using plug-ins for processing, plenty of people also want to use hardware effects units and processors within their Pro Tools mixes, either because there isn’t a plug-in equivalent or because the hardware just sounds better.
